background-status-msg-line1-part1

CLJ8550-MIB · .1.3.6.1.4.1.11.2.3.9.4.2.1.1.2.37.1.1

Object

scalar optional r/w DisplayString
The string displayed on the device's front panel in
place of the printer's built-in background status
string.  An example built-in background status string is
'00 READY'.
Additional information:
 The display size for the Color LaserJet8550 printer is 2 by 16.
			     The value of this object is displayed on the first
			     line and the value of 
			     BACKGROUND-STATUS-MSG-LINE2-PART1 is displayed on
			     the second line of the display. Each object must
			     be set independently. If line 2 has been set, and
			     the next message to be displayed only requires 
			     line 1, BACKGROUND-STATUS-MSG-LINE2-PART1 must be
			     set to the null string to clear it.  
			     This object allows a message to be displayed when 
it is the highest priority message waiting to be
			     displayed. Setting this object does not guarantee 
			     the message will be displayed; and reading it 
			     returns the value last written, not the currently 
			     displayed message.   
The priority assigned for displaying this message 
is one lower than the PJL RDYMSG.  
To clear the message, write a null string to both
			     this object and 
			     BACKGROUND-STATUS-MSG-LINE2-PART1.  
			     While the object prtConsoleLocalization controls 
			     the localization and symbol set usage of printer 
			     generated messages, this object's message is 
			     displayed using the symbol set (note: The default 
			     symbol set is Roman-8 for HP - EFI may vary) 
			     specified with the string. The default symbol set 
			     is Roman-8; additional legal symbol sets are 
			     ISOLatin5, ISOLatin2, HalfWidthKatakana, and
			     ISOLatinCyrillic.   
			     When either BACKGROUND-STATUS-MSG-LINE1-PART1 or 
			     BACKGROUND-STATUS-MSG-LINE2-PART1 contains a 
			     non-null value, both will be displayed.
